Searle: Many market indexes already are the equivalent of Dow 6000. The Russell 2000 small cap index has plunged about 38% -- almost twice as much as the Dow. The oil service index has plunged over 60%. But the Dow is off less than 20%.

We saw a similar pattern in the 1973-75 bear. The broad market collapsed early on but the blue chips of the day held up relatively well until the very end. But they finally got creamed. And that marked the end of the bear.

I do not see how this bear can end until today's blue chips finally get smashed big time. Mo less a personage than Zeev Head now sees the Dow going as low as 6200 next year before the bear ends.
